Intel 800-Series Platform, Supported By The New LGA 1851 Socket

With the chips and their performance out of the way, the next topic that we have to discuss is the platform. For its Arrow Lake lineup, Intel is introducing a brand new socket which ends the reign of the LGA 1700 series after a little over three years. The new socket from now onward will be LGA 1851 and this will be first featured on the new 800-series motherboards.

The 800-series chipsets will include several SKUs but the one we are getting today is the top-tier Z890. This platform offers a total of 48 PCIe lanes of which 20 are PCIe Gen 5.0 and these come from both the CPU and the PCH. The Z890 PCH features up to 24 PCIe 4.0 lanes, up to 4 eSPI, up to 10 USB 3.2 ports including 5 20G, 10 10G, and 10 5G options, up to 14 USB 2.0 links & up to 8 SATA III links.

The new platform is further enriched with the latest features which include:

Integrated I/O:

  • Up To 2 Thunderbolt 4 ports
  • Intel Killer Wi-Fi 6E (Gig+)
  • Bluetooth 5.3 (LE)
  • 1 GbE

Discrete I/O:

  • Up To 4 Thunderbolt 5 ports
  • Intel Killer Wi-Fi 7 (5 Gig)
  • Bluetooth 5.4 (LE)
  • 2.5 GbE

In terms of memory support, the new Z890 motherboards will offer up to DDR5-6400 (native) capabilities and expanded speeds over 8000 MT/s with XMP. The platform will support up to 48 GB DIMMs in the dual-channel mode for up to 192 GB capacities in UDIMM, CUDIMM, SODIMM, and CSODIMM flavors.

Lots of Goodies For Overclockers!

Finally, we have the new overclocking goodness which comes in the form of new functionalities for tuners with fine grain control.

These features include:

  • Granular core clock - Top turbo frequency in 16.6 MHz steps for P-Cores and E-Cores
  • Dual base clock - Run an independent BCLK for SOC and compute tiles
  • Tile-to-Tile & fabric OC - Can apply a static/BIOS ratio and supports dynamic ratio changes for fabric
  • DLVR bypass - Bypass the internal voltage management using an external supply for extreme OC
  • Intel eXtreme tuning utility - New features including automated OC enhancements
  • Memory overclocking - New memory controller supports new XMP and CUDIMM DDR5
  • P & E-core overclocking - P-core per-core V/f control, and E-Core per cluster V/f control
  • Low-temperature overvolting - Increasingly bypass voltage limits as the chip gets colder

The cooler operation of the chips also provides higher headroom for overclockers. As for the TJmax, Arrow Lake-S "Core Ultra 200S" will have a peak operating temperature of 105C.
